Default Re: BB q5 WiFi issues

Did you try doing a soft reset? There are two methods. One is by holding down the up and down volume buttons. You will hear the device make a screen shot, and keep holding until the device starts into the rebooting cycle. The other method is by holding the power button down for about 10 seconds. If you try it one way and the problem persists, then try the other method and test again.

Other ideas.... You can do a reset to factory defaults using BlackBerry Link. Do a full backup first, and IMPORTANT you must know the BlackBerry ID if you are running OS 10.3.2. If the problem is corrupt settings, this should fix it. Test before you restore. If the problem returns after a restore, then it would see the corrupt settings are in the backup.

To rule out a software glitch you will need to do a clean OS install using Link. Again, test before you restore.

Hopefully a soft reset fixes the problem.
